What is the difference between Internship High Risk Security vs Security Guard?

AspectInternship High Risk SecuritySecurity Guard
CredentialsBasic security certifications, internship experienceSecurity guard license, certifications often required
Work EnvironmentHigh-risk areas, training environments, temporary assignmentsVarious settings like malls, events, buildings
Employer & IndustrySecurity firms, training programs, internshipsPrivate security companies, retail, corporate

Internship High Risk Security roles focus on training and gaining experience in high-risk environments, often requiring certifications and supervised tasks. Security Guards perform ongoing security duties in various settings, with a focus on protection and surveillance. While both roles involve security work, internships are more educational and entry-level, whereas security guards are active personnel responsible for safety.

IMA's Executive Risk Solutions (ERS) team is seeking a Specialist to join our group! This is a great opportunity for anyone looking to start or continue their career in the Business Insurance space by working closely within the ERS team and alongside other IMA servicing teams and carriers to meet client needs. A successful applicant must have strong problem-solving abilities, be adaptable, possess professionalism, and strong communication and relationship building skills. This role can be located in our Wichita, KS, Overland Park, KS, or Denver, CO offices and is eligible for hybrid scheduling!
ESSENTIAL JOB RESPONSIBILITIES: include but are not limited to:
  • Supports and demonstrates IMA's core values
  • Values and understands the importance of diversity, equity, and inclusion among all IMA associates.
  • With moderate guidance:
    • Send out detailed renewal requests to service teams within IMA
    • Preliminarily check and compare new and renewal quotes comparing to expired programs / policies and applications for coverage
    • Limited brokering of Executive Risk deals may be required
  • With minimal guidance:
    • Policy processing in accordance with IMA workflow standards
    • Maintain EPIC data integrity
    • Pull applications as requested by P&C service teams
    • Follow up on quotes due for the ERS team as requested
    • Send bind requests in accordance with the instructions provided by ERS associate
    • Follow up and review binders for accuracy and work with other service teams to deliver seamless internal service
    • Follow-up with service teams on subjectivities needed for policy issuance and finalize with insurance carriers
    • Record keeping (I.e. extensions, revenues, renewal dates, etc.) / Business tracking
    • Produce historical renewal data for ERS team and service teams
    • EPIC related data entry for all ERS associates / file documentation
  • Foster relationships (P&C team, insurance carriers, etc.) and collaboration with different IMA divisions and offices

REQUIRED EXPERIENCE AND SKILLS: include but are not limited to:
  • Highly organized and ability to manage multiple priorities
  • Bachelor's Degree preferred or equivalent experience
  • Intermediate Microsoft Office skills preferred
  • Property & Casualty License preferred but not required
  • Written and verbal communication competencies required
  • Critical:
    • Tracking all tasks to applicable deadlines
    • Ability to handle high volume demands accurately with little lead time
    • Ability to respond timely and accurately
